David Murray <rdmur...@bitdance.com> added the comment: In this case it is not a potential security hole, since in fact the "GPF" comes from Python explicitly calling Abort because of a situation it can't handle, as indicated by the error message from Python. (If it were a true segfault-like error, there would be no message from Python itself.)
